Parisian Gnocchi

Recipe By : Cooking Light, June 1994, page 88
Serving Size : 40 Preparation Time :0:21
Categories : Miscellaneous

Amount Measure Ingredient -- Preparation Method
-------- ------------ --------------------------------
1 cup 1% low-fat milk
1 tablespoon margarine
1/2 teaspoon salt
1 cup all-purpose flour
2 eggs
2 egg whites


Combine first 3 ingredients in a large saucepan; bring to a boil over medium heat, stirring frequently. Remove from heat; gradually add flour, stirring vigorously with a wooden spoon until mixture leaves sides of pan and forms a ball. (Dough will be dry and crumbly.) Let cool 3 minutes.

Add eggs and egg whites, one at a time, beating after each addition. (Dough will not be smooth.) Spoon dough into a pastry bag fitted with a 1/2-inch round tip; set aside.

Bring 14 cups of water to a boil in a large Dutch oven. Pipe half of dough directly into boiling water, cutting dough with a sharp knife every 2 inches to form 20 gnocchi. Cook 2-1/2 minutes. Remove gnocchi with a slotted spoon, and place in a colander to drain; repeat procedure with remaining dough. Yield: 40 gnocchi (serving size: 10 gnocchi).
